Hi everyone...

I'm a Canadian citizen who will be sponsoring my Indonesian wife. I'm currently in Indonesia with my wife, and we're both in the process of completing the application.

If you take a look at this webpage:

http://www.cic.gc.ca/english/information/applications/guides/3999Etoc.asp

you will see that it says:

Mailing instruction

Put the completed forms, supporting documents required for your sponsor in a 23 cm x 30.5 cm (9″ x 12″) envelope.
Send your completed application to your sponsor’s Canadian address.



Does the envelope have to be exactly 23cm x 30.5cm?? We have tons of proofs, and we likely need a box....

Our plan is to separate the entire thing into 3 sections:

Envelope 1: my forms and supporting documents

Envelope 2: my wife's forms and supporting documents

PLUS: a box containing all the relationship proofs. Mostly they're in A4 size, weighing around 3,3 kg (7,26 pounds)

Then, those 3 things (envelope 1 + envelope 2 + box), we will put into a box that is big enough to contain the 3. And then we will mail this single box to CPC-Mississauga...

Hopefully that's acceptable??
 
It really doesn't matter, I'm sure they prefer envelopes over boxes but if you have too much then it's fine. The reason it states that is to keep people from folding their papers to fit into regular envelopes. I've heard of other people sending boxes with no problems at all.

fandv said:
Mailing instruction

Put the completed forms, supporting documents required for your sponsor in a 23 cm x 30.5 cm (9″ x 12″) envelope.
Send your completed application to your sponsor's Canadian address.

That looks like instructions for the applicant in another country to mail their info to their sponsor in Canada... NOT the CIC.

As mentioned, you can mail your app to the CIC any way you like.
